What therapy approaches are used for stress?
Common therapeutic approaches for stress include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) (7,210 therapists), Client-Centered Therapy (6,183 therapists), Solution-Focused Therapy (5,801 therapists), Motivational Interviewing (4,708 therapists), Mindfulness Therapy (4,611 therapists). Each approach has different strengths, so discuss with your therapist which method best fits your situation.
What other issues do stress therapists commonly treat?
Stress therapists frequently also specialize in Anxiety (100%), Depression (88%), Self esteem (85%), Coping with life changes (77%), Relationship issues (77%). This overlap means your therapist can address multiple concerns in a holistic treatment plan.
